What Avory Means

Avory is a variant spelling of Avery, an English name derived from the Old French name 'Alberic', meaning 'ruler of the elves'.

Avory is a variant of Avery, an English name tracing back to the Old French 'Alberic,' meaning 'ruler of the elves.' This enchanting origin suggests a lineage connected to myth and leadership, a name that has traveled from medieval courts to modern times.
